Battery Specifications
The Backwoods battery is designed with a robust 1100mAh capacity, ensuring extended use on a single charge. It features a voltage range of 3.3V to 4.8V, adjustable via a convenient twist wheel, allowing users to customize their vaping experience. The battery supports a wide resistance range of 0.7Ω to 3.0Ω, making it compatible with various cartridges and coil setups. Its compact design and portable nature make it ideal for outdoor enthusiasts. The battery also includes a preheat mode, activated by pressing the button twice, to prepare cartridges for optimal vapor production. With these specifications, the Backwoods battery offers a reliable, versatile, and durable vaping solution, catering to both beginners and experienced users. Its universal 510-thread compatibility further enhances its adaptability across different cartridge types.

4.1 Charging Process
Charging the Backwoods battery is straightforward and efficient. Begin by connecting the battery to the provided USB charger, ensuring it is properly seated. The LED light will turn red, indicating the charging process has started. Allow the battery to charge fully, which typically takes 2-3 hours. Once the LED light changes to green, the battery is fully charged and ready for use. It is important to avoid overcharging, as this can reduce the battery’s lifespan. Always use the charger provided with the device or a compatible alternative to ensure safety and optimal performance. For best results, store the battery in a cool, dry place when not in use. Proper charging habits will help maintain the battery’s longevity and reliability. Follow these steps to ensure your Backwoods battery performs at its best.

Activating the Battery
Activating the Backwoods battery is a straightforward process designed with safety and user convenience in mind. To turn the battery on, press the power button five times rapidly. This child-resistant feature ensures the device cannot be accidentally activated. Once activated, the battery will blink to confirm it is ready for use. You can vape by either pressing the power button or using the inhale activation feature, depending on your preference. To turn the battery off, repeat the same process of pressing the power button five times. Always turn off the battery when not in use to conserve power and prevent unintended activation. For added safety, detach the cartridge when the battery is not in use. This ensures a secure connection and prevents accidental firing during storage or travel. Proper activation and deactivation are essential for maintaining the battery’s performance and longevity.
Operating the Device
Operating the Backwoods battery is simple and intuitive, ensuring a smooth vaping experience. Once the battery is activated, attach a compatible cartridge by screwing it securely into the 510-thread connection. Make sure the cartridge is tightly fitted to avoid any connectivity issues. Before vaping, consider using the preheat mode by pressing the button twice. This feature gently warms the cartridge for consistent vapor production, especially useful in colder climates or with thicker oils. To vape, you can either press and hold the power button or use the inhale activation feature, depending on your preference. Start with a lower voltage setting and adjust as needed for optimal flavor and vapor. Always monitor the LED indicator for battery status and ensure the device is turned off when not in use to conserve power. Regular cleaning of the connections with rubbing alcohol will maintain performance and prevent residue buildup.

Maintenance and Storage
Proper maintenance and storage of the Backwoods battery are essential for preserving its performance and longevity. To maintain the device, clean the battery contacts regularly using a cotton swab dipped in rubbing alcohol to remove residue and oil buildup. Avoid using harsh chemicals or excessive moisture, as they can damage the battery.
For storage, keep the Backwoods battery in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ight and moisture. Turn the battery off when not in use to prevent accidental activation and conserve power. Store the battery in a protective case or silicone sleeve to shield it from scratches and physical stress. Avoid storing the battery fully charged or completely depleted for extended periods, as this can affect its capacity over time. By following these guidelines, you can ensure the Backwoods battery remains in optimal condition for a satisfying vaping experience. Regular care and proper storage will extend its lifespan and maintain its reliability.
